" Attractive three bedroom character mid terraced property situated in the popular residential area of Seaforth, close to local shops, Schools, transport links and amenities. The accommodation on offer briefly comprises; entrance hallway, two reception rooms, kitchen / diner, first floor landing, three bedrooms and a bathroom WC. The property benefits from gas central heating complemented by double glazing. Outside the property there is a garden area to the front and an enclosed yard to the rear.
